Output e95af753c57735e2712bcc9c1607f1331ec444f77b3ceb7c1597f6dbc32a03d0:3

value
26697453286
script pubkey
OP_0 OP_PUSHBYTES_20 d82e85126e134c1b8dde3e8ceb3290fe946b3bf2
address
ltc1qmqhg2ynwzdxphrw786xwkv5sl62xkwljpmas0y
transaction
e95af753c57735e2712bcc9c1607f1331ec444f77b3ceb7c1597f6dbc32a03d0
spent
true